#include <CsPadRotationGlobalV1.h>
Public Types | |
NQuad = Psana::CsPad::MaxQuadsPerSensor | |
NSect = Psana::CsPad::SectorsPerQuad | |
NUMBER_OF_PARAMETERS = 32 | |
enum | { NQuad = Psana::CsPad::MaxQuadsPerSensor } |
enum | { NSect = Psana::CsPad::SectorsPerQuad } |
enum | { NUMBER_OF_PARAMETERS = 32 } |
Public Member Functions | |
CsPadRotationGlobalV1 (const std::vector< double > v_parameters) | |
double | getRotation (size_t quad, size_t sect) |
void | print () |
CsPadRotationGlobalV1 () | |
virtual | ~CsPadRotationGlobalV1 () |
This software was developed for the LCLS project. If you use all or part of it, please give an appropriate acknowledgment.
Definition at line 51 of file CsPadRotationGlobalV1.h.
anonymous enum |
anonymous enum |
anonymous enum |
pdscalibdata::CsPadRotationGlobalV1::CsPadRotationGlobalV1 | ( | const std::vector< double > | v_parameters | ) |
pdscalibdata::CsPadRotationGlobalV1::CsPadRotationGlobalV1 | ( | ) |
Definition at line 43 of file CsPadRotationGlobalV1.cpp.
References PlotSpectralArrayFromFile::arr, NQuad, and NSect.
pdscalibdata::CsPadRotationGlobalV1::~CsPadRotationGlobalV1 | ( | ) | [virtual] |
Definition at line 82 of file CsPadRotationGlobalV1.cpp.
double pdscalibdata::CsPadRotationGlobalV1::getRotation | ( | size_t | quad, | |
size_t | sect | |||
) | [inline] |
Definition at line 59 of file CsPadRotationGlobalV1.h.
void pdscalibdata::CsPadRotationGlobalV1::print | ( | ) |